About The Conference
The Inaugural interdisciplinary research Conference
The University of Guyana Berbice Campus (UGBC) proudly presents its inaugural interdisciplinary
international research conference, titled “Embracing Innovations and Change through Interdisciplinary
Perspectives.” Scheduled to take place from June 23–26, 2025, this in-person conference will be hosted at
UGBC’s campus in Tain Village, Corentyne, Berbice, Guyana.
This landmark event serves as a platform for academics, practitioners, industry leaders, policymakers, NGOs,
and community organizers to come together in a spirit of collaboration, inquiry, and transformation. As the
world faces increasingly complex challenges, the need for interdisciplinary dialogue and innovation has
never been more urgent.
Themes and Focus Areas
Climate-smart and sustainable agricultural practices
Climate-resilient health and environmental practices
Public health crises (e.g., gender-based violence, suicide, social
challenges)
Lifelong learning and vocational education
The role of universities in community development
Entrepreneurship and innovation

Migration, cultural identity, and social inclusion
Rural community development and partnerships
Technology (e.g., artificial intelligence, digital literacy, media and
society)
Economics and public policy
Literature and cultures
These themes reflect pressing issues within the Caribbean, Latin American, and broader Global South contexts, while offering room form comparative global perspectives.
